# Spanish Professor Retakes the Stage

*November 20, 2023* — by [Audrey Bartholomew ’23](/author/audrey-bartholomew-23)


> Concert in Chile to Reunite His Influential 1990s Rap Group

*Jose Magro 1920x1080 — Over Thanksgiving break, rapper José Magro, a visiting research professor of Spanish, is reuniting with his bandmates for a performance in Santiago, Chile.*

José Magro talks with his Spanish students at the University of Maryland about language and power, sprinkling his lectures with snippets of hip-hop.

Three decades ago, mic in hand in Madrid clubs, he did the reverse, injecting his hip-hop with antiracist and anti-fascist political messages as part of one of Spain’s most influential rap groups.

Magro has maintained his hip-hop career even as the assistant clinical professor built a reputation in academia as an expert on incorporating antiracism into the teaching of the Spanish language in U.S. classrooms. And as Americans gather on Thanksgiving to celebrate a holiday rooted in the experience of British colonists, Magro will return to the stage in Chile. He’ll reunite with his five bandmates in El Club de los Poetas Violentos (The Violent Poets Society, later shortened to CPV) at Teatro Coliseo in Santiago, for the 25th anniversary of their trailblazing Spanish hip-hop album “Grandes Planes” (Big Plans). Presale tickets have sold out.
